Main Page
Namespaces
Classes
Package Documentation
RecoVertex
PrimaryVertexProducer
interface
TrackClusterizerInZ.h
Go to the documentation of this file.
1
#ifndef TrackClusterizerInZ_h
2
#define TrackClusterizerInZ_h
3
10
#include "
FWCore/ParameterSet/interface/ParameterSet.h
"
11
#include <vector>
12
#include "
TrackingTools/TransientTrack/interface/TransientTrack.h
"
13
14
15
16
17
class
TrackClusterizerInZ
{
18
19
20
public
:
21
22
TrackClusterizerInZ
(){};
23
TrackClusterizerInZ
(
const
edm::ParameterSet
& conf){};
24
25
virtual
std::vector< std::vector<reco::TransientTrack> >
26
clusterize
(
const
std::vector<reco::TransientTrack> &
tracks
)
const
=0;
27
28
virtual
~TrackClusterizerInZ
(){};
29
30
};
31
32
#endif
TrackClusterizerInZ::TrackClusterizerInZ
TrackClusterizerInZ()
Definition:
TrackClusterizerInZ.h:22
TrackClusterizerInZ::~TrackClusterizerInZ
virtual ~TrackClusterizerInZ()
Definition:
TrackClusterizerInZ.h:28
TransientTrack.h
TrackClusterizerInZ::TrackClusterizerInZ
TrackClusterizerInZ(const edm::ParameterSet &conf)
Definition:
TrackClusterizerInZ.h:23
TrackClusterizerInZ
Definition:
TrackClusterizerInZ.h:17
ParameterSet.h
l1t::tracks
Definition:
MicroGMTCancelOutUnit.h:12
TrackClusterizerInZ::clusterize
virtual std::vector< std::vector< reco::TransientTrack > > clusterize(const std::vector< reco::TransientTrack > &tracks) const =0
edm::ParameterSet
Definition:
ParameterSet.h:36
Generated for CMSSW Reference Manual by
1.8.11